White River Junction, Vermont, is one of 5 villages within the town of Hartford, Vermont. The town of Hartford was originally chartered in 1761 and over time was divided into these distinct villages. Today, White River Junction has been designated a National Historic District replete with nearly 2 dozen historical downtown buildings.
Nearby, White River Junction VA Medical Center promotes research to discover knowledge, develop VA scientists and health care leaders, and create innovations that advance health care for Veterans and the nation.
